I only have 200 Miles on my DH but today when driving I was scrolling through display and noticed that the voltage is only 13 volts. During the trip it jumped to 13.5 at one point then back down to 13. I am used to vehicles that put out a range from 13.8 to 14.2 what are you seeing on your center display?

It depends if your battery needs to charge or not. If it was at 13 volts, you're battery is charged and the alternator doesn't need to be putting out a higher charge.

I put the meter on the battery and it read 12.5 volts, started car and it read 12.5 volts and slowly rose to 14.2 volts, revved engine to 2000 rpm and voltage dropped to 13.2 volts. I just had the battery replaced and was convinced the alternator was bad. Took it back to dealer and got a lesson on modern electronics. Like every thing else on this car, a computer runs the alternator. In this case the PCM meters power as needed to the electrical system. The tech demonstrated how it works by putting the meter on the battery and it showed 12.5 volts and then he turned on the lights and the meter went to 13.5 volts. Turned the lights off and the meter slowly started coming down. Driving around you will see anywhere from 12.5 volts to 14.5.
